Kisantu Michel Kiese

Kisantu Michel KieseMichel came to the UK from Congo in 2003.  He came to JET in May 2008 looking for help to get work experience in finance.

Michel has a degree in Mathematics and ran his own business in Congo for nearly 20 years. Since coming to the UK he has completed a Diploma in Payroll Management with the Institute of Certified Bookkeepers and had been applying for jobs in this area without any success. The feedback that he had from employers was that he needed to get some UK work experience.

JET helped Michel to update his CV, write a cover letter and discussed where he could look for work experience. We also facilitated a short placement with Home Group in their Finance department.
Michel has also arranged some voluntary work with the Oxfam Finance department. He will now use this experience to apply for work, with ongoing support from the JET team.

Michel had this to say about JET, “I am very happy for all JET has done for me, when I finished my studies as a full bookkeeper I did not know where to start about work placement. I send CVs everywhere but no positive response has been given to me. They told me I need some experience before I start to work, I was wondering where I can get experience, the experience is coming with the work, if you work then you get experience, if you don't work you can't get experience, I was getting stuck and I was looking for an help.

When I met Hilary from JET she helped me about how to make a CV and cover letter, she showed me where to apply for working experience and bring me at Home Group where I am doing the volunteering work for getting experience.  I would like to thank JET for the support that I got from them.”
